Space Marshals, as we could translate the name of the game, is set in a future where it is possible to travel from planet to planet without problems. The story begins with the journey of space marshals transporting prisoners. But their ship is attacked and the villains disappear. At that moment, you find yourself in the role of Marshal Bart and you have the task of finding and neutralizing the escaped bandits.

The entire story is divided into several missions, each with a slightly different task. Sometimes you'll have to free your friends, other times you'll have to shoot your way to the boss himself and neutralize him, or use a combination of clever ambushing and getting access keys to get to the spaceship.

For these tasks, Marshal Bart is always armed with a one-handed and two-handed weapon and two types of grenades or other "throwing" material. The controls are quite simple, so it does not prevent you from fully enjoying the atmosphere of Space Marshals while playing. On the left side of the display you control the movement, on the right your weapon (can be thrown), you don't need more. Tap the display to crouch and enter the so-called "sneak" mode.

Then the success of the mission depends on your chosen tactics. Individual missions always take place in a different environment, but we always find a combination of western and alien buildings and characters. Great 3D graphics and great music push the shooter a little higher. In the game itself, you will find everything you would expect from a similar event that you are watching from above the whole time.

In addition to killing enemies who are armed differently, you can collect lives along the way, recharge your weapons, but also look for hidden hints that will improve your overall score. There are also various instant enhancements such as invisibility or the need to find a card to open various doors, which the most dangerous villains usually have with them.

When you complete all the tasks and successfully return to the base, each mission is scored based on how many times you were killed during it, how many designated high priority targets you eliminated, etc. Then you can always choose a bonus item accordingly - a new hat, a vest, rifle, grenade and much more.

The developers really had no shortage of ideas when coming up with a fresh western space world and ways to eliminate the enemy. At the moment, the only complaint is that only the first chapter of the story is available. Pixelbite promises that there will be two more to come, and if both are free, then the higher price will be completely justified. However, the developers have not yet decided on the price of the following chapters. If you like top-down shooters with strategic elements, then definitely give Space Marshals a try.
